No, it's because most C-dramas are dubbed even though they use the same language. I don't really know the real reason why they do that but here in I Hear You, the FL wants to be a professional voice actress so sometimes you would hear some Japanese words in Mandarin accent which are also dubbed. But those scenes are just a few seconds you won't really mind it imo.
